How Much Does an Incident And Problem Manager Make in New York?

Updated April 24, 2024
Filter

Individually reported data submitted by users of our website

Low Confidence
$125,965/yr
Average Base Pay
Low $111,397
Average $125,965
High $142,440
The average salary for Incident And Problem Manager is $125,965 per year in New York.

Frequently Asked Questions About an Incident And Problem Manager Salaries

What is the average of an Incident And Problem Manager in New York?

The Incident And Problem Manager salary range is from $111,397 to $142,440, and the average Incident And Problem Manager salary is $125,965/year in New York. The Incident And Problem Manager's salary will change in different locations.

Which location pays the highest Incident And Problem Manager salary in the United States?

The Incident And Problem Manager salary in San Jose, CA is $148,299 which is the highest in the US.

What kinds of reasons will influence the Incident And Problem Manager's salary?

Besides the location, employees' education degree, related skills, and work experience also will influence the salary. Try to improve your skills and experience to get a higher salary for the position of Incident And Problem Manager.
